Information and results obtained from IoT Platform in Valencia Pilot

Description

 The IoT platform allows the geolocation of the container, as well as manage the information of the filling level and traceability of trucks.  The eco driving application on board of the truck sends the data from the truck (location, speed, RPM and engine load) t o the IoT platform where it is stored. At the same time sound alarms are emitted when driver excess the ecodriving parameters in the Android application. Besides this, the application receives from the IoT platform the position of the containers that must be collected.

In this way the driver can see the position, order of collection of the containers and pathway to collect them, as explained above.
The IoT platform receives the information of the labels dispensed from the smart containers. The score of the characterized bags were registered in the platform as explained in the next section. 

Attached the different data sets generated during the project.
